Functional polymorphism of the glucocorticoid receptor gene associates with mania and hypomania in bipolar disorder.
Bipolar disorders - 1 Feb 2009
Spijker Anne T, van Rossum Elisabeth F C, Hoencamp Erik, DeRijk Roel H, Haffmans Judith, Blom Marc, Manenschijn Laura, Koper Jan W, Lamberts Steven Wj, Zitman Frans G
Abstract excerpt
OBJECTIVES: In affective disorders, dysregulation of the hypothalamus-pituitary-adrenal (HPA) axis is a frequently observed phenomenon. Subtle changes in glucocorticoid receptor (GR) functioning caused by polymorphisms of the GR gene (NR3C1) may be at the base of the altered reaction of the HPA axis to stress and subsequently related to the development and course of affective disorders.
